Putting the guides opposite the effective spine gives what many feel is the best overall qualities of casting and fish fighting ability. Another good placement is to put the guides so that the fish is pulling against the stiffest axis (this won't necessarily be 180 degrees opposite the spine) and provides the most lifting power. ..........
